Title The Founder Freedom Flywheel: Why Growth Alone Won’t Give You Your Life Back Show Notes Most founders don’t start a business because they want more stress, more complexity, and more dependency on themselves. They start because they want freedom, impact, financial strength, and a better life for the people they love. But here’s the hard truth: a business can be growing and still be unhealthy. A founder can look successful and still feel trapped. A leadership team can be busy and still fail to execute well. In this episode of the TriMetric Roadmap Podcast, Scott and Jeff unpack why founder freedom is not created by fixing one isolated part of the business. Better meetings, cleaner roles, dashboards, and documented processes can all help, but they do not solve the whole problem by themselves. That is why Business Freedom Advisors uses the TriMetric Flywheel to look at a founder-led company through three connected lenses: Business Health — Is the company structurally healthy? Executive Performance — Is the leadership team functioning at the level the business now requires? Life Quality — Is the business producing the life the founder actually wants? Scott and Jeff explain how these three areas work together, and why ignoring any one of them can create hidden costs in the business, the founder’s marriage, family, health, energy, or freedom. They also unpack the simple but powerful rhythm of the TriMetric Flywheel: Truth → Alignment → Action First, get honest about what is really happening. Then create alignment with the right people. Then move into focused action through a 13-week execution cadence. This episode is especially relevant for family-focused founders who want to grow without sacrificing the people and priorities that matter most. In This Episode Scott and Jeff discuss: How business growth can hide deeper dysfunction Why founder freedom requires a holistic view The difference between business health, executive performance, and life quality Why executive performance sits between business health and founder freedom How truth, alignment, and action create momentum Why outside diagnostics help reveal blind spots The danger of living and leading from empty How 13-week CSIs turn strategy into focused execution Why the goal is not just a better business, but a better life Key Takeaway Founder freedom does not come from more revenue alone. It comes from building a healthier business, stronger leadership infrastructure, and a life that stays aligned with what matters most.
